Tempest 3 is a multi-platform terminal client designed for server management, supporting SSH, SFTP, and Mosh connections. It distinguishes itself with advanced features like real-time terminal collaboration, Kubernetes cluster management, and an AI-driven agent for task execution.

Key features
An AI agent that executes terminal commands and completes tasks rather than just providing chat-based assistance.
Allows multiple users to join a live terminal session for shared debugging and troubleshooting.
Provides tools for syncing kubeconfigs and managing pods with AI-assisted workflows.
Supports SSH, SFTP, and Mosh, with the latter providing persistent sessions on unstable network connections.
Includes end-to-end encrypted cloud sync and an optional post-quantum cryptography key exchange.
